U.S. Implements New Visa Restrictions Targeting Cybercrime, Sextortion
The U.S. government announced a new visa restriction policy on July 23, 2026, targeting individuals linked to cybercrime, including online investment scams and sextortion. The policy extends to immediate family members of those implicated. Officials cite online investment scams defrauding U.S. citizens of at least $10 billion in 2024.

Pentagon Officials Seek $67 Billion in Supplemental Funding
Senior Pentagon officials recently briefed Congress, stating the conflict in Iran has incurred $37.5 billion in costs. They requested an additional $67 billion for military resupply.

Trump Administration Issues Executive Order on Childhood Vaccine Recommendations
The Trump administration issued an executive order today concerning childhood vaccine recommendations. The directive suggests evaluating the measles, mumps, and rubella (MMR) vaccine for potential separation into three individual doses. It also mandates federal health officials to enhance vaccine research efforts.

Study: Most Americans Believe Brands Overcharge Amid Inflation
A recent Omnisend study reveals 85% of Americans think brands use inflation as an excuse for higher prices. This perception correlates with 56% of consumers reportedly stopping purchases from previously favored brands.

Iran Outlines Conditions for Strait of Hormuz Reopening Amid Standoff
Iran has issued a new set of demands to U.S. President Donald Trump and American negotiators concerning the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z. These conditions include a prohibition on U.S. threats and insults, the withdrawal of military forces, and compensation for damages.

Tribal Gaming Regulator Lacks Chairperson Amid Industry Growth
The National Indian Gaming Commission, responsible for a $46 billion tribal gambling industry, faces operational challenges without a chairperson. This leadership vacancy occurs as tribal gaming revenue reached a record high in 2023.
